The opportunity: As a Tender Specialist at Hitachi Energy's Indian Operations Center (INOPC), you will contribute to the development of a global value chain, aiming to optimize value for Hitachi Energy customers across markets. Specifically, you will support the Transformer Business for Power Transformer Factory - Kartal throughout the Tendering Process. How you'll make an impact: - Sell Transformers to customers, focusing on volume, mix, and profitability targets. - Prepare offers in coordination with the bid and proposal department and/or the Marketing Manager, ensuring appropriate technical and financial aspects are included. - Manage administrative procedures in Sales and Project management process. - Establish and maintain effective customer relationships to understand needs, promote understanding of offerings, and provide solutions. - Prepare sales plans and propose recovery plans in cases of potential order shortfalls. - Create added value for customers and Hitachi Energy, ensuring successful outcomes of transactions. - Identify and drive the development of new market opportunities, promoting knowhow sharing and cross-collaboration. - Uphold Hitachi Energy's core values of safety and integrity. Your Background: - Bachelor's degree in electrical engineering with knowledge in Transformer/Power Substation. - 1-3 years of hands-on experience in Transformer Sales. - Strong written and verbal communication skills with excellent organization and time management. - Ability to handle high load capacity by setting priorities. - Proficiency in Microsoft Office tools (Excel, Word, PowerPoint) and SalesForce. - Proven interpersonal abilities with various stakeholders. - Proficiency in both spoken and written English is required. Develop and implement maintenance plans for Power substation 66KV, LT distribution panel, DC caster, Furnaces, Hot rolling, Cold rolling mills, Sliting, Pickling, Utilities. 2. Breakdown & Emergency Repairs i. Lead quick response to unplanned breakdowns, minimizing downtime. ii. Conduct root cause analysis (RCA) and implement permanent corrective actions. 3. Equipment Management Inspection, servicing, Power substation, DC Caster, Cold Rolling Mills, Motors, & utilities. 4. Team Leadership i. Supervise and guide the teams. ii. Plan manpower for shifts, maintenance schedules, and shutdowns. 5. Safety & Training i. Ensure all maintenance work complies with safety standards. ii. Maintain inspection records and statutory compliance. iii. Conduct skill training and ensure safety discipline. 6. Shutdown & Turnaround Planning i. Prepare detailed plans for annual or major shutdowns. ii. Coordinate with production, stores, purchase and vendors for smooth execution. 7. Spare Management i. Maintain adequate stock of critical spare parts for casting and rolling equipment & Utilities. ii. Standardize parts to reduce costs and lead time. 8. Budgeting & Cost Control i. Monitor expenses and implement cost-saving measures. 9. Vendor & Contractor Coordination i. Manage AMC and other vendors visits for cranes, Compressor, etc. ii. Supervise contract labour for maintenance jobs. 10. Documentation & Reporting i. Maintain history cards, maintenance logs, failure analysis reports. ii. Report on key metrics: Downtime, MTTR, MTBF, availability, Maintenance cost per ton & other KPIs.

Job Title: PSS Engineer (Experienced) Experience: 1 to 5 Years Job Locations: Bettiah & Darbhanga, Bihar Key Responsibilities: Installation, testing, commissioning, and maintenance of Power Sub Station(PSS). Conduct routine inspections and troubleshoot electrical issues in substations. Coordinate with utility providers and ensure compliance with safety and quality standards. Prepare technical reports, documentation, and site updates. Support project execution teams during field operations. Requirements: Diploma/B.E./B.Tech in Electrical Engineering or related field. 1 TO 5 years of hands-on experience in substation or electrical infrastructure projects. Strong understanding of electrical drawings, protection systems, and HT/LT equipment. Willing to work on-site at project locations (Bettiah and Darbhanga). Basic computer skills for reporting and documentation. Benefits: Stable monthly salary Travel and on-site allowances (if applicable) Opportunity to work on live infrastructure projects
